NCW asks actor Payal Ghosh to file complaint against Anurag Kashyap with it

NCW asks actor Payal Ghosh to file complaint against Anurag Kashyap with it

New Delhi, Sep 20 (UNI) National Commission for Women (NCW) chief Rekha Sharma on Sunday said she will look into actor Payal Ghosh's tweet complaining about alleged sexual assault by director Anurag Kashyap in 2014-15.
The NCW chief said she had asked the actor to file a detailed complaint for her to look to the matter and take up
the issue with the police.
Ms Sharma, in a WhatsApp video, said she got to know about the alleged assault after the actor tweeted about
it. She shared the link of the process to file a complaint with the NCW, and added that the organisation will
look into the matter.
Payal on Saturday shared a video of her interview with a regional news channel, where she reportedly made
the charge of the incident that occurred around 2014-15. She claimed that the director called had asked her to
a room and then sought sexual favours from her.
Kashyap has brushed aside the allegations, terming them "baseless and lies" and an attempt to silence
him.
